Brian Routh - Cyber Me

Am I a person or am I a book?
On the hard drive I look so fine and slick
Better get it on the website double quick.
Is it me is it not?
Who am I…I forgot.
How many megabytes am I?
'Trigabytes! ' I hear my laptop cry.
Now I am in my system folder
Buried deep and so much older.
Try to find me if you can
Ask Jeeves or Google if I’m the man?
I live forever in Cyberspace
An epitaph to the human race
No longer am I flesh and bone
But numbers in the computer zone.
A JPEG here a PDF there
I’m FTP’d everywhere.
Upload, download, refresh, save,
Join the new computer slaves.
My mobile plugs into my ear
Adds to my brain an extra gear.
Now I am an external drive
Am I dead or am I alive?
Connected to the Internet
It doesn’t matter if I forget,
My memory’s out there on the web
An eternal Cyberspace celeb.
Brian Routh
